Editors announce first album with new member Blanck Mass and share new single "Karma Climb"
Editors have announced their seventh album and first since welcoming Blanck Mass as a full-time member, EBM, and have released new cut "Karma Climb" to accompany the news.
"Karma Climb" is Editors' second outing from EBM, following April's "Heart Attack", and is teamed with a Hand Held Cine Club-directed video.
Lead vocalist Tom Smith says of the new song, "It's about hedonistic escapism, not only from the world generally, but also from what people think of you."
EBM will follow Editors' 2018 album Violence, and will be their first since welcoming frequent collaborator Blanck Mass into the band as a full-time member.
The album title is an acronym of Editors and Blanck Mass, and is also a reference to Electronic Body Music, which has heavily influenced the band's new album.
Smith said of working with Blanck Mass, real name Benjamin John Power, "Ben has certainly been a shot of adrenaline in our creative process. The songs are so immediate, and in your face."
